Meaning of "post mortem"

The term 'post mortem' is derived from Latin and commonly used in medical or forensic contexts to refer to an examination or analysis conducted after death. It involves investigating the cause of death, determining the deceased's medical history, or identifying any pathological conditions or injuries

  • Having been inflicted or having occurred after death.
  • Occurring after death.
  • An investigation of a corpse to determine the cause of death.
  • Any investigation after the conclusion of an activity, particularly when said activity produces an unwanted outcome.
